The C and C++ Include Header Files
/usr/include/python3.12/internal/pycore_atexit.h
$ cat -n /usr/include/python3.12/internal/pycore_atexit.h 1 #ifndef Py_INTERNAL_ATEXIT_H 2 #define Py_INTERNAL_ATEXIT_H 3 #ifdef __cplusplus 4 extern "C" { 5 #endif 6 7 #ifndef Py_BUILD_CORE 8 # error "this header requires Py_BUILD_CORE define" 9 #endif 10 11 12 //############### 13 // runtime atexit 14 15 typedef void (*atexit_callbackfunc)(void); 16 17 struct _atexit_runtime_state { 18 PyThread_type_lock mutex; 19 #define NEXITFUNCS 32 20 atexit_callbackfunc callbacks[NEXITFUNCS]; 21 int ncallbacks; 22 }; 23 24 25 //################### 26 // interpreter atexit 27 28 struct atexit_callback; 29 typedef struct atexit_callback { 30 atexit_datacallbackfunc func; 31 void *data; 32 struct atexit_callback *next; 33 } atexit_callback; 34 35 typedef struct { 36 PyObject *func; 37 PyObject *args; 38 PyObject *kwargs; 39 } atexit_py_callback; 40 41 struct atexit_state { 42 atexit_callback *ll_callbacks; 43 atexit_callback *last_ll_callback; 44 45 // XXX The rest of the state could be moved to the atexit module state 46 // and a low-level callback added for it during module exec. 47 // For the moment we leave it here. 48 atexit_py_callback **callbacks; 49 int ncallbacks; 50 int callback_len; 51 }; 52 53 54 #ifdef __cplusplus 55 } 56 #endif 57 #endif /* !Py_INTERNAL_ATEXIT_H */
